Is white chocolate chocolate?
Yes, because it contains cocoa butter. Around 50% of every cocoa bean is made up of cocoa butter. After separating the cocoa butter, we are left with cocoa powder.
What is white chocolate?
White chocolate is a type of chocolate made from cocoa butter, sugar, and milk. Unlike other types of chocolate, it does not contain whole cocoa beans, which is why it doesn't have a brown color.
White chocolate composition:
Cocoa butter
Cocoa butter is the essential ingredient of high-quality white chocolate. Cocoa butter is obtained from cocoa beans and is rich in fats and antioxidants.
Sugar
Sugar is the second ingredient in white chocolate. It provides the sweet taste.
Milk
Milk is the third ingredient in white chocolate. For Míša's chocolate, we use dried Czech milk.
And what is the composition of our white chocolate?
In first place is cocoa butter, followed by milk powder and cane sugar. We also add vanilla beans from Madagascar. When you buy chocolate (and not just white), study the ingredients carefully. In supermarket white chocolates, sugar is in first place. In our chocolate, cocoa butter is in first place, which means the chocolate contains more butter than sugar. Thanks to this, the chocolate is smooth and not oversweetened. Cocoa butter is healthy; sugar is not.
